Lego Harpsichord

Tuesday, May 13th, 2008

I’ve always liked the sound and look of the Harpsichord. I’ve always liked Legos. Now the two have been successfully merged into a working Harpsichord made from Legos! About 100,000 pieces went into this thing!

Lego Harpsichord

Found at HenryLim.org via Dark Roasted Blend.

Ooops!  I forgot mention (Thanks John!), you can hear it in action at the HenryLim site linked above!

The Willows look to Salem

Wednesday, February 13th, 2008

The Willows, a band local to the North Shore area, has decided to put together an album inspired by the Salem, Massachusetts amusement park of the same name.  Linehan, an H.P. Lovecraft fan, has create some upbeat music with some earie Lovecraftian lyrics.

Still, a concept album about an old amusement park that was originally set up as a place for smallpox patients to recuperate can be kind of a hard sell.

The Willows will be playing at the Dodge Street Grill in Salem on February 15th at 9:30.

Forma Tadre: “The Music of Erich Zann”

Tuesday, January 15th, 2008

After eight years away, Forma Tadre gives us “The Music of Erich Zann”, an album based on the Lovecraft story of the same name.  It will be available January 19th for download from the iTunes store only.

I might have to check this one out.  “The Music of Erich Zann” has always been one of my favorite HPL stories.  Speaking of which, you can also find an excellent reading by Finlay Patterson of Yog-Sothoth.com fame.
